Last night, courtesy of the inimitable Jasmin Way, I attended my first ever NY Fashion Week event—the Anna Sui show.
Of course, Kelly Osbourne was there. Which is, you know, NOT COOL because I had the name first.
Anyway, here are some general observations re Fashion:
- There is a great deal of milling about in Fashion. In fact, the majority of the experience—like, first 20-30 minutes we were there—involves idly gazing at millers-abouters on the runway.
- Thankfully, the runway was covered with a tarp so that no millers-abouters inadvertently scuffed the surface.
- When the tarp comes up and the fashion show finally does start, it only lasts 15 minutes. Tops.
- But it’s pretty gorgeous in the meantime.
- Anna Sui’s spring 2011 line can best be described as: Flapper Seventies. Or, as Sara and I worked out, “Bohemian Prohibition.”
- Models really are quite pretty.
